The Numbers Behind Blood Pressure Reduction When researchers combine results from many studies, they find that GLP-1 medications lower systolic blood pressure (the top number) by: 2 to 6 mmHg on average when compared to placebo Semaglutide: about 3 to 5 mmHg reduction Liraglutide: about 2.5 to 3 mmHg reduction Tirzepatide: about 7 to 11 mmHg reduction (the most powerful) These numbers might seem small, but they matter
